Transaction 31f094669c420ed54dd8e48f6a1ce176f96ad9585f40671a04c177ee95da500a
1 Input
1 Output
-
31f094669c420ed54dd8e48f6a1ce176f96ad9585f40671a04c177ee95da500a:0
- value
- 164475
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 95efde2896b9d77ad67a204af708e0737f6419f8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Efo2tdQL38QKHYzEoJELPF8Ywb1GA8RZF